BI 1415 - Principles of Biology II Lecture & Lab

Hours: 5
This course is the second course in a two-course sequence intended for biology majors and that continues the study of biological concepts and principles. In lecture, the focus is on classification, anatomy and physiology, evolution, and ecology of mainly eukaryotes including protists, fungi, plants and animals. The laboratory portion of this course will reinforce topics covered in the Principles of Biology II lecture and the emphasis is on scientific method, data collection and reporting, problem solving and critical thinking.

Lecture/Laboratory: Three hours of lecture and minimum of four hours of lab per week.
Prerequisite: Minimum grade of “C” in BI 1325  
Prerequisite/Corequisite: SC 1000
